netflix-zuul

    15熱度

    2回答

    我寫的時候我就開始服務,由一個zuul幾個春天啓動基於微服務的前置式 它的工作原理基於反向代理的應用我的機器,但對於服務器推出,我想使用docker進行服務,但現在看起來這是不可能的。 通常情況下,您將在容器外部有一個固定的「內部」端口和隨機端口。但容器中的應用程序不知道外部端口(和IP)。 Netflix的工具搭配什麼,我希望寫一個高效的微服務架構和概念上我真的很喜歡泊塢窗。 據我所見,啓動容器

    1熱度

    2回答

    我試圖對將使用Zuul的項目使用spring-cloud棧。在我的組織中,我們有一個基於xml的自定義配置堆棧,並執行屬性組合和分層覆蓋。由於處理這種配置的方式,我努力爲它創建一個PropertySource。 我的自定義PropertySource必須使用我的配置bean,但由於PropertySources在啓動bootstrap期間被初始化,所以應用程序上下文尚未完全初始化,而且我無法訪問我

    3熱度

    1回答

    我是Netflix開放源代碼項目的忠實粉絲。他們做了一些非常酷的東西。 我建立了一個Zuul,工作正常。創建了所有類型的過濾器,並且這些過濾器被動態加載並運行 我現在試圖做的是在過濾器內部使用Hystrix。我所看到的是,如果一切順利,一切正常。但是,當run()方法內部存在異常時,Zuul會捕獲它而不是Hystrix。所以getFallback()永遠不會被調用。我的代碼Github。 有人有任

    2熱度

    1回答

    我想用自定義的一個具有附加特性/自定義項的嵌入在zuul包中的現有RibbonRoutingFilter替換。 這僅僅是創建我自己的一個案例,並給予它優先級觸發內置之一?我不希望這被調用兩次。 其實要澄清最後一點。我想我的版本取代內置的版本。我創建了一個RibbonRoutingFilter的副本,添加了我的自定義設置,並按照我想要的方式工作,但原始的RibbonRoutingFilter也被調用

    3熱度

    1回答

    我已經在端口8761上運行的服務器尤里卡(本地主機:8761 /尤里卡),我有一個Zuul應用程序,我想與尤里卡註冊,但我不斷收到同樣的錯誤: Can't get a response from http://localhost:8761/eurekaapps/ZUULSERVER Can't contact any eureka nodes - possibly a security grou

    2熱度

    1回答

    我嘗試使用Spring雲Netflix中使用的反向代理Zuul。 我已經從春季博客上發現的教程開始項目(https://spring.io/blog/2015/02/03/sso-with-oauth2-angular-js-and-spring-security-part-v) 但我不確定我是否正確理解了Zuul的角色。 如果我去localhost:8080/login,我認爲Zuul會代理我的

    7熱度

    1回答

    我想寫一些自己定製的zuul過濾器,用於我正在編寫的spring cloud microservice。一旦我編寫了過濾器,我該如何整合它,以便底層netflix zuul框架可以利用它。

    1熱度

    1回答

    我們有一個Zuul預過濾器(Filter1),它將檢查傳入的HTTPServletRequest並對其中的查詢參數進行一些更改,以將其嵌入到自定義創建的請求(包裝HttpServletRequestWrapper)中。 現在,我想將這個自定義封裝的請求傳遞給下一個Zuul預過濾器(Filter2)。我怎樣才能做到這一點 ? 此前經常使用Servlet過濾器時,我們使用在我的過濾器1 chain.d

    7熱度

    4回答

    啓動應用項目: @SpringBootApplication @EnableZuulProxy public class ZuulServer { public static void main(String[] args) { new SpringApplicationBuilder(ZuulServer.class).web(true).run(args);

    10熱度

    1回答

    我注意到彈簧雲ZUUL強制執行隔離信號量,而不是線程默認值(如Netflix的推薦)。 在org.springframework.cloud.netflix.zuul.filters.route.RibbonCommand註釋說: 我們要默認信號量隔離,因爲這種包裝是已經跟帖隔離 2人的命令而我依然不明白這一點:-(什麼是這兩個其他命令? 配置這種方式,Zuul只能調度負載,但不允許超時,讓客戶走